React中如何使用native全局变量,相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。
RN中有两种方式使用全局变量
1.通过导入导出文件的方式
新建constants.js文件
constobject={ website:'http://www.hao123.com', name:'好123', }; exportdefaultobject;
需要用到的时候导入文件
importconstantsfrom'./constansts.js' <Text>{constants.name}</Text>
还可以有另外一种导入文件的写法
exportdefault{ website:'http://www.hao123.com', name:'好123', };
2.通过声明全局变量的方式
一定是先声明,后调用。
global.a=1; <Text>{a}</Text>
也可以专门写在一个文件当中。
global.constants={ website:'http://www.baidu.com', name:'百度', };
调用方法,入口文件一次调用(比如index.ios.js文件),全局使用。
import'./constants.js'; <Text>{global.constants.name}</Text>
看完上述内容,你们掌握React中如何使用native全局变量的方法了吗?如果还想学到更多技能或想了解更多相关内容,欢迎关注恰卡编程网行业资讯频道,感谢各位的阅读!
React不将Vite作为构建应用的首选原因是什么
如何使用自定义hooks对React组件进行重构
如何使用自定义hooks对React组件进行重构这篇文章主要介绍了...
基于React和Socket.io实现简单的Web聊天室
React Native Popup怎么实现
怎么使用react-activation实现keepAlive支持返回传参
React中jquery怎么引用
React中常用的两个Hook是什么
React中常用的两个Hook是什么这篇文章给大家分享的是有关Re...
React组件中的state和setState如何使用
React组件中的state和setState如何使用本篇内容主要...
vue和react中的diff有哪些区别
vue和react中的diff有哪些区别这篇文章主要介绍“vue和...
怎么用Three.js+React实现3D文字悬浮效果
用户名
密码
记住登录状态 忘记密码?
邮箱
确认密码
我已阅读并同意 用户协议